Does INK/Poteet have a state child-care violation history?

Texas HHSC records list 10 child-care citations for INK/Poteet in POTEET, TX. The state assigns each cited standard a risk level; for this facility, 4 are recorded at the High level and 2 at Medium High, with the remainder at Medium, Medium Low, or Low. Each entry below reproduces the standard Texas cited and the state's own description of what was found.

These are licensing-record findings, not a judgment about any child or family. The dates shown are the dates Texas recorded a correction as verified — they are not inspection dates, and the record may lag the state's current file. This page reflects the published record as of its last update and is not a complete history; the authoritative source is Texas HHSC.

  1. Correction verified May 27, 2022High

    746.2805(1) - Prohibited Punishments - Corporal Punishment

    Caregiver/ alleged perpetrator pulled children up by the wrist and drug a child across the floor.

  2. Correction verified May 27, 2022High

    746.1203(4) - Responsibilities of Caregivers- Supervision of Children

    Caregiver/alleged Perpetrator closely observed two children kicking a child on the floor without intervention from the caregiver.

  3. Correction verified May 27, 2022High

    746.1201(1) - Responsibilities of Employees and Caregivers -Demonstrate Competency, Good Judgment, Self-control

    The caregiver/ alleged perpetrator placed her knee on a child to keep the child on the cot.

  1. Correction verified November 10, 2021High

    746.5101(a) - Annual Fire Inspection - Before Initial Permit Issued and Every 12 Months

    The operation lacked a current fire inspection.

  2. Correction verified May 3, 2022Medium High

    746.5537(a)(2) - Electronic or Battery-Operated Carbon Monoxide Detector-Check All Detectors Monthly

    Carbon Monoxide detector smoke detectors and fire extinguishers had not been recorded monthly.

  3. Correction verified November 10, 2021Medium High

    746.3401(a) - Annual Sanitation Inspection

    The operation lacked a current health inspection.

  4. Correction verified May 3, 2022Medium

    746.2207(c)(4) - Screen Time Activities - Not Used During Eating or Rest Times

    Children in the headstart classroom were allowed to have screen time with tablets during naptime.

  5. Correction verified April 21, 2022Medium

    746.4135(b) - Children's Products- Annual Certification

    The required Consumer Product Safety Commission form has not been completed within the last year.

  6. Correction verified November 9, 2021Medium

    746.1305(a)(1) - Pre-service Training- Developmental Stages

    Two out of five staff files lacked pre service training.

  7. Correction verified November 9, 2021Low

    746.1105(3) - Minimum Qualifications Child Care Center Employees and Caregivers - Affidavit

    Four out of Four caregivers files lacked a affidavit signed by a notary.
